About Jow Y. Lew
Jow Y. Lew is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Biotechnology and Physiology, having authored 15 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(5 papers), Enzyme-mediated dye degradation (3 papers) and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Physiology (131 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(421 citations) and Plant Science (666 citations). Jow Y. Lew has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Sweden and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Leland M. Shannon, Ernest Kay, Menek Goldstein, Kjell Fuxé, Jöelle Hillion, Michèle Zoli, Enric I. Canela, Sergi Ferré, Vicent Casadó and Luigi F. Agnati.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and PLANT PHYSIOLOGY.
